The Role of Genes & Family History in Fertility

Posted on March 19, 2025 by Inception Fertility

When struggling to conceive, it’s natural to wonder if genetics are to blame. Can family history impact your fertility? The short answer: probably not significantly—but in some cases, it can play a role.

Understanding Infertility

The American College of Obstetricians and Gynecologists (ACOG) defines infertility as the inability to conceive after one year of unprotected intercourse for women under 35. For women 35 and older, this timeframe shortens to six months before seeking evaluation from a reproductive endocrinologist.

Infertility is complex and can be influenced by hormonal, anatomical, and lifestyle factors—but family history and genetics contribute to only a small percentage of cases.

How Family History Might Affect Female Fertility

1. Polycystic Ovary Syndrome (PCOS)

PCOS is one of the most common causes of ovulation disorders. While its exact cause is unknown, research suggests a genetic link—meaning if your mother or sister has PCOS, you may be at higher risk.

2. Endometriosis

Endometriosis occurs when tissue similar to the uterine lining grows outside the uterus, leading to pain and possible infertility. Studies, such as this one published by the National Institutes of Health (NIH), indicate that women with a family history of endometriosis are more likely to develop the condition.

3. Uterine Fibroids

Fibroids are benign growths in the uterine muscle that can interfere with implantation or pregnancy. If your mother had fibroids, you may have an increased likelihood of developing them.

4. Early Menopause and Ovarian Reserve

A woman’s egg count naturally declines with age, but early menopause (before age 40) can sometimes run in families. Certain genetic conditions, such as Fragile X syndrome, are linked to diminished ovarian reserve, which can impact fertility.

How Genetics Might Affect Male Fertility

For men, fertility is often linked to sperm quantity and quality. While lifestyle and environmental factors are primary influences, some genetic conditions can impact sperm production:

  • Y chromosome microdeletions: Missing genetic material on the Y chromosome can lead to low sperm count or infertility.

  • Klinefelter syndrome (XXY): A condition where a man has an extra X chromosome, often resulting in impaired sperm production.

  • Other inherited conditions: A family history of developmental delays in male relatives may indicate a genetic condition that could impact fertility.

The Role of Genetic Testing and Counseling

While most fertility challenges are not inherited, understanding your family history can be useful. If you or your partner have a family history of infertility, early menopause, PCOS, endometriosis, fibroids, or genetic disorders, discuss this with your doctor.

Genetic screening can help:

  • Identify inherited conditions that could affect your fertility or the health of your future child.

  • Assess risk factors for chromosomal abnormalities.

  • Guide personalized fertility treatment options.
